Rainwater Harvesting Systems offers an environmentally conscious plumbing service that involves the planning and setup of systems to gather, hold, and utilize rainwater for secondary applications. These systems typically feature catchment surfaces, filtration units, and storage tanks, supporting sustainable water use in landscaping, toilet flushing, and washing. Properly configured systems reduce water bills and contribute to resource conservation
